Printing Estimates: Choosing the Marketing Mix that Will Fit Your Budget

Marketing is the heart of any business, and budget is the life blood of any marketing campaign. When writing your marketing plan, get printing estimates from printing companies for a variety of printing services. This will go along way in helping you stretch your thinning budget.

Outdoor Advertising

1. If you're business can make use of walk-in sales, then outdoor advertising is the backbone of your advertising efforts. It advertises to a large audience within the proximity of your business. Because it is visible to passers-by of all demographics, it also advertises to those that may be missed by more selective advertising.

2. Print quotes or estimates for posters vary depending on the volume of print. Digital poster printing can be very pricey but are useful for individual pieces. Wholesale poster printing on the other hand will work best for more than a hundred posters.

3. The cost of posters per unit goes down drastically with a change in volume. You should consider this when computing for the scale of advertising. A few extra dollars will barely make a dent on your budget, but it can make a big difference.

4. You can also look into the price difference of having generic posters printed by a few thousands and reposted through out the year (or a few years) and having a few hundred printed every season or for every promotional.

Targeted Advertising via Mailing List

1. Direct-mail-advertisements are useful to businesses who expect to make more than a few dollars for each customer. Other than the cost of printing, there is also the cost of mailing out these prints to the prospective client. And because this is a one-to-one advertisement, the cost per customer may seem high.

2. This kind of advertising though has a higher response rate than poster printing. It zooms in on your targeted demographic or to people who show interest in your business. You start making assumptions about who your target market are and validate this from your experience of which you're customers are. You can obtain a mailing list for people with the same demographic from mailing list providers.

3. To make a good Return on Investment or ROI, the goal of this strategy is to go beyond one time sales, and instead look into long term repeat sales from the client. Brochures and catalogs aim to educate. This is ideal for unique products that have unique benefits.

4. It can work to build a habit or a lifestyle the client can subscribe into. For example, a specialty coffee shop can send a brochure explaining the health benefits of brewed coffee over instant coffee.

5. Direct mail like postcards, brochures and the like can also be used to sustain a relationship with your customers. Postcards are a popular choice for direct mail as they are less costly to print and send out with a high success rate.

6. Prints for direct mail can be ordered conveniently from online printing companies that have extended their services to include design, mail presorting, and arranging with the postal service for bulk mail. This means, you can orchestrate your direct mail advertising online with ease.

Direct-mail and outdoor advertisements used simultaneously can build up the effectiveness of each other. Use printing estimates to formulate the marketing mix that will give you the highest success rate for your business without breaking the budget.
